We are in the heart of the tournament season for Division I Wrestling. Big Tens was entertaining as expected.

The Iowa Hawkeyes qualified nine for the 2024 NCAA National Wrestling Championships to be held in Kansas City, Missouri on March 21-23. Iowa finished fourth in the team race.

You always hope for as many qualifiers as possible and for everyone to stay healthy. We got the nine qualifiers with every weight except 184 and I am hoping we came out of Big Tens in good health.

Overall, Iowa wrestled above their seeds at Big Tens. Three wrestlers placed exactly at their seed (141,157,165). We had four wrestlers finish above their seed (133,184,197, Hwt) and three finish below their seed (125,149,174).

Placement/Seed at Big Tens

125 – Drake Ayala 3rd/#2

133 – Brody Teske 5th/#14

141 – Real Woods 3rd/#3

149 – Caleb Rathjen 5th/#3

157 – Jared Franek 4th/#4

165 – Mike Caliendo 3rd/#3

174 – Patrick Kennedy 5th/#3

184 – Aiden Riggins 10th/#13

197 – Zach Glazier 2nd/#3

Hwt – Brad Hill  5th/#7

The biggest match for me all weekend was the first round at 133. #14 seed Brody Teske was behind #3 seed Nic Bouzakis of Ohio State 13-6 at the start of the third period. Teske chose down. When the dust cleared from a wild third period Teske won the match 15-13 with two back points at the end. That is the definition of Iowa Wrestling and a match I will not soon forget.

The 2024 NCAA wrestling Division I championship brackets will be revealed during a selection show streamed live on NCAA.com at 7 p.m. CST on Wednesday, March 13.
